  • Rhodium(III) chloride, also known as rhodium trichloride, is a valuable transition metal compound commonly used in chemical synthesis for its unique properties. In organic chemistry, Rhodium(III) chloride is often employed as a catalyst in various reactions due to its ability to facilitate difficult transformations with high efficiency. Its catalytic activity can promote the formation of carbon-carbon and carbon-heteroatom bonds, leading to the production of complex organic molecules. Additionally, Rhodium(III) chloride is utilized in the preparation of organorhodium compounds, which can act as intermediates in organic transformations. With its role in promoting selective and sustainable synthesis pathways, Rhodium(III) chloride has become a versatile tool for researchers and industrial chemists alike.
